3.50 nC of charge is consistently distributed in a solid Styrofoam ball of radius 2.00 cm cantered at x = 2.00 cm on the x-axis of a Cartesian coordinate system. -1.25 nC of charge is consistently distributed on a fibreglass spherical shell of radius 5.00 cm cantered on the source of the same coordinate system. What is the value of the electric flux by an imaginary spherical shell of radius 6.00 cm cantered on the source of the coordinate system in question?
